Minutes – Management Meeting, Arbourline Freight

Attendees: heads of department. The renewal of our fleet policy with Corvane Assurance was reviewed in detail. The quoted premium rises 11%, attributed to two depot incidents. Operations will supply updated safety records to support a reduction. Decision deferred one week pending a comparison quote. Departments should hold off on new vehicle commitments. A confidential note is appended below.

board note of yadup-fajef: Druiusox Holdings is in early talks to buy Norwynek Systems for about $186.0 million. The Kaseth launch date is June 24, and nothing goes to the press before then. Legal wants the Quenethek Group term sheet withdrawn before November 27.

## First-Aid Room — Quinby House

Welcome aboard! The first-aid room is on the ground floor, just past the Ketterell meeting pods — look for the green cross on the door. It's stocked with the usual kit plus an eyewash station, and there's a list of trained first-aiders pinned inside. The room stays locked outside office hours, so it's worth saving the door code now. Here it is.

door code, yagap-bahof: bdg-O-05

Step 4: Enable EXIF scrubbing on Pixelmoor before routing upload traffic to the new ingest cluster. The scrubber strips GPS tags, camera serials, and embedded thumbnails at write time; originals are never retained. Verify the worker pool is drained before toggling the flag, since in-flight uploads bypass the filter. Apply the following configuration to the ingest nodes:

deployment values, kajep-kageg:
[praix]
host = praix.paliqcorp.corp
user = praix_svc
database = praix_prod